LETTER OF CONDOLENCE TO SIR MOSES MONTEFIORE ON THE PASSING OF HIS SISTER, SENT BY THE OFFICERS OF THE CHURVAS RABBI YEHUDA HACHASID SYNAGOGUE IN YERUSHALAYIM. 1874.


Letter dated 1874, sent by the officers of the Churvas Rabbi Yehuda Hachasid Synagogue in Yerushalayim, expressing condolence to Sir Moses Montefiore on the passing of his sister. They inform him that her name has been entered into the Pinkas of the synagogue for special prayers and lighting of candles, during the first year and on her yarzeit.
The second part of the letter refers to a solution found for problems experienced due to the location of a well on the Synagogue premises.

The letter is signed by the Synagogue officers, including: Rabbi Eliyahu Sarason, Rabbi of Peizer, Rabbi Aryeh Leib Marcus of Keidan and Rabbi Baruch b. Rabbi Yehuda Leib.

Rabbi Eliyahu Sarason, Rabbi of Peizer, and Maggid in Yerushlayim. Author of Nishmas Chaim and Ugas Eliyahu.

Rabbi Aryeh Leib Marcus of Keidan (1800-1877), Leader of the Kollel Perushim in Yerushalayim and a founder of the Churvas Rabbi Yehuda Hachasid Synagogue.

1 side. 23 x 29 cm. Very good condition.
